Output 88809a51d423ecb9b16390585d4a82913035a6553f80f6db12399930d57c6244:1

value
12359837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 962659b87357fc0fa4d46f835e7b2d2ccf89d810 OP_EQUAL
address
3FNwDxPMe73m9UkYQEacpX7KvbCcbeA2iJ
transaction
88809a51d423ecb9b16390585d4a82913035a6553f80f6db12399930d57c6244
spent
true